58 Georgia Employers That Hire Veterans
58 employers in Georgia cleared the federal veteran-hiring benchmark in filing cycle 2025, between them hiring 1,772 protected veterans out of 16,734 new hires — 10.6% overall, against a national benchmark of 5.1%. The largest by veterans hired are Delta AIR Lines Inc., Scientific Research Corporation and Norfolk Southern Corporation.

Veteran hiring in Georgia concentrates in Transportation & Logistics (755 hires), Professional, Scientific & Technical (553 hires) and Manufacturing (160 hires).

What this list is not. It is a track record, not a job board — the data describes a past filing cycle, so an employer here may or may not be hiring today. Check their careers page. It is also not a ranking of who treats veterans best; it counts hires, which is one honest signal among several.
Self-identification is voluntary. Employees choose whether to disclose protected-veteran status, so these figures generally understate how many veterans an employer really has. That cuts one way only: everyone on this list is at least as good as the number shown.
We filtered out obvious filing errors. Some filings report a veteran hire rate wildly out of step with the same employer's overall veteran workforce — a column filled in wrong, not a recruiting record. Those are excluded rather than celebrated.
Source: U.S. Department of Labor VETS-4212 filings, cycle 2025, and the OFCCP national hiring benchmark of 5.1% effective 30 July 2025. LockLeed International is not affiliated with the Department of Labor or OFCCP.
